I have a .50 Lyman Trade Rifle. It needs a little work, though nothing ambitious. It’s set by my workbench waiting for me for too long so it’s time for it to move along.

The issue is the toe of stock, which was damaged in transit. I clamped and glued it and had intended to install a toe plate to clean it up more, but that’s where things stalled. The butt plate is included, as are the screws to mount it. I haven’t reattached the butt plate since gluing and believe it will need tweaked as it likely got bent slightly when the chip occurred. It was also missing the barrel wedge, which is now included but it new and will require a little fitting.

That’s it for the work. The bore is pristine. If I had to guess, I’d presume never fired. Stock is otherwise in good condition with a few scratches and imperfections. Some tarnish on the trigger guard.
